使用Redis缓存只需几行代码(redis缓存几行代码)
使用Redis缓存:只需几行代码
随着技术的发展,缓存在软件开发中扮演着越来越重要的角色。在互联网应用中,缓存可以显著提升应用程序的性能,降低数据库压力,减少服务器负载。Redis是一款高性能的NoSQL数据库,它支持缓存功能,可以帮助我们轻松实现缓存。本文将介绍如何使用Redis缓存,只需几行代码。
准备工作
在开始使用Redis之前,需要先安装Redis服务器,具体步骤请参考Redis官方文档。安装好Redis后,需要在代码中引入Redis库。Python用户可以通过以下命令安装Redis库:
“`python
pip install redis
连接Redis
在使用Redis之前,需要先与Redis服务器建立连接,我们可以通过以下代码实现:
```pythonimport redis
# 建立Redis连接r = redis.Redis(host='localhost', port=6379, db=0)
其中,host是Redis服务器的地址,port是Redis服务器的端口号,db代表要连接的数据库编号。默认情况下,一个Redis服务器可以支持16个数据库,编号从0到15。可以通过db参数指定要连接的数据库。
设置缓存
在与Redis服务器建立连接后,可以使用Redis提供的set方法设置缓存。以下代码演示了如何设置一个字符串类型的缓存数据:
“`python
# 设置缓存
r.set(‘key’, ‘value’)
其中,key代表缓存数据的键,value代表缓存数据的值。
获取缓存
在设置缓存后,可以使用Redis提供的get方法获取缓存数据。以下代码演示了如何获取一个字符串类型的缓存数据:
```python# 获取缓存
result = r.get('key')
其中,result变量存储了获取到的缓存数据。
删除缓存
有时候,我们需要从缓存中删除某个数据,可以使用Redis提供的delete方法实现。以下代码演示了如何删除一个缓存数据:
“`python
# 删除缓存
r.delete(‘key’)
以上是使用Redis缓存的基本操作。在实际应用中,还可以使用Redis提供的其他操作实现更加复杂的缓存策略,如设置缓存过期时间、批量操作等。Redis是一款高性能的NoSQL数据库,它支持多种数据类型,如字符串、列表、集合、有序集合等,可以满足不同场景的缓存需求。还等什么?赶快使用Redis缓存,提升你的应用程序性能吧!